“Decent, I've been to way worse. If you want to use the vending machines, bring cash. There's some seating but due to people leaving buffer seats it's actually a bit limited. They do not have enough rolling carts even on weekends, so bring a basket or cart of your own. They have 3, 5 and 8 load dryers, as well as tiny, regular, and massive washers. FYI they pre-charge your card $15 so be prepared to see that. I was able to get 95mbps down and 22mbps up in their wifi, which uses Spectrum internet.”
